ipod issue


so i finally tried using my ipod with slackware. i have only one weird hiccup.

im using amarok and when i transfer something to it everything works fine... i finish doing what im doing and i disconnect and umount it. when i go to the ipods menu what i transfered is right there. when i click to play it though... nothing happens. no error, no software freeze, no message of any kind.. just nothing. i connected it to the mac and it wouldnt play the new tracks either. plays everything else fine... just not the stuff i transfered with amarok... ive never heard of this before.

anyone even know where i could start looking for info about this?

oh and here is my fstab entry...

Code:
/dev/sdd2	/home/nick/Music/ipod_mount vfat noauto,user,rw,sync,nodev,nosuid,umask=0000 0 0

ahh... real quick update. im playing aroud with it a little bit and i chose to search the ipod for Stale and Orphaned files. everything i transfered is there under both the stale (in the ipod database but cannot find the file) and orphaned (file on the device but not in the database) list.

so it is there... i think im just having issues being able to add things to the database.

anyone have any idea?

I had iPod-troubles on Slackware too, and I'm not the only one, see this thread:

http://www.linuxquestions.org/questi...d.php?t=496597

The short answer seems to be that you need to recompile amarok, after which everything will function correctly (at least, that was what happened in my case ). For your convenience, I've put my own amarok-package (recompiled using the slackbuild distributed with the slackware sources) on the web,

Yeah, I can confirm that if you grab the latest amarok (1.4.4) and recompile, everything works great.
